Job Summary

The Land Development Division provides technical review and oversight of land development applications manages performance and erosion and sediment control bonds maintains land development records provides professional guidance to other County agencies related to land development and provides exemplary customer service.
The Bonds Technician plays a key role in the land development process in Loudoun County. This position serves as a bonds technician of the bonds team that processes hundreds of performance and grading bonds in a year and maintains on average $ in bonds at any given time. Bonds play a vital role in the land development process. Bonds link together key development review divisions and safeguard important infrastructure during project construction. This position ensures that bonds process is administered efficiently and accurately. Additionally the Bonds Technicians ensure that each performance and grading bond meets regulatory minimum standards. They begin the record-keeping process and are the primary point-of-contact for the development community for incoming performance and grading bonds. Bonds Technicians also play a critical customer service role in relation to bonds.

Primary responsibilities of the Bonds Technicians include: Intake and processing of performance and grading bonds and determining their conformance with County regulations; Processes bond extensions agreements bond reductions releases substitutions and riders; Assists in the coordination of sending extension letters for all bonds; Assist in the compiling of the bi-monthly Bond Committee Minutes; Assists in generating key performance metrics for presentation to Bond Committee; Conducts the final closeout of all bonds; Provides technical expertise and advises on issues regarding performance agreement submissions; and Acts as a subject matter expert for any external question related to bonding.

This temporary bonds technician position will be assigned responsibility for managing Performance Bonds identified as being in default issuing corresponding notices handling
communications related to extensions and resolving past-due agreements to
mitigate legal risks. Duties include verifying and updating bonded project contact
information invoicing processing extension requests and recording Extension Fee
revenue and liabilities accurately within the correct fiscal year. The position will also be responsible for reporting and calculating revenue and liabilities overdue by fiscal year and document processing times. This position will be responsible for providing regular bi-weekly status updates to management for reporting purposes. Other duties related to bond processing may be assigned as necessary.
